Who We Are
Tronox Holdings plc (NYSE: TROX) is the world’s leading integrated manufacturer of titanium dioxide pigment. We mine titanium-bearing mineral sands and operate upgrading facilities that produce high-grade titanium feedstock materials, pig iron and other minerals. With 6,600 employees across six continents, our rich diversity, unmatched vertical integration model, and unparalleled operational and technical expertise across the value chain, position Tronox as the preeminent titanium dioxide producer in the world. Today, with $3.3 billion in annual revenue, we are the second largest in our industry, providing products that add brightness and durability to paints, plastics, paper, and other everyday products.

Position Overview
This position will be responsible for any planning regarding the human resources and development of a company’s workforce, and they must be able to transform all policies into executable plans and departmental procedures. He/she will be responsible for managing and coordinating the company’s Human Resources Business Partner function to meet the company’s business requirements. To align and execute the HR strategy for the Business which supports the South Africa HR strategy to ensure that business objectives are met.
Primary Responsibilities
Responsibilities:
- Provides coaching and advice to management on a variety of people issues regarding personnel practices and employment law.
- Challenges the organizational structure of the internal client and proposes changes.
- Works within corporate strategies and policy frameworks to design and implement human resources strategies.
- Develops guidelines and procedures which assist line management in implementing human resources programs.
- Ensures compliance of the organization’s practices with applicable labour legislation and collective labour agreements.
- Manages and motivates subordinate staff; reviews and assesses performance, builds employee capacity.
- Manages and resolves complex employee relations issues.
- Secures professional legal support from internal or external legal counsel as required.
